Mah Jongg Tile Set Description

Tile Set Name: LGHTHOUS.TIL
Subject:       Lighthouses of the US (Plus one Canadian)
Created by:    Larry Brown, Prairie Village, KS
Version:       1.2
Date:          April 17, 1991

Description:

This set is a depiction of several day marker styles found on 
Lighthouses in North America.  The lights noted below 
provided inspiration for those shown.  They may not show the exact 
configuration but the thought is there!  Others are just
variations on a theme.
